Turkiye conveys condolences to Pakistan on Islamabad mosque attack

Advertisement

ISLAMABAD – The Turkish government expressed deep condolences on Sunday following a tragic bomb blast that occurred at a mosque in Islamabad, Pakistan, resulting in numerous casualties. Deputy Prime Minister and Foreign Minister Ishaq Dar spoke with Turkish Foreign Minister Hakan Fidan on the same day, conveying heartfelt sentiments from President Recep Tayyip Erdogan.

Ishaq Dar echoed his appreciation for Turkey’s solidarity during this difficult time and reaffirmed Pakistan’s unwavering commitment to combating terrorism and ensuring the safety of its citizens. The deputy prime minister highlighted how crucial it is to maintain national security and stability in a region that often grapples with such threats.

During their conversation, both leaders discussed bilateral relations as well as various matters of mutual interest, including important regional developments.

In separate comments, China also condemned the incident, emphasizing support for Pakistan’s efforts. The Chinese foreign ministry stated, “We are deeply shocked by Friday’s attack and mourn the loss of life.”

The attack in question occurred at a mosque when an assailant had managed to breach its gates before detonating a suicide bomb that left at least 31 people dead and many more injured. This was described as one of the deadliest such attacks since the city saw similar incidents over a decade ago.

“China is deeply shocked by the deadly explosion in Islamabad, Pakistan’s capital, and we mourn the lives lost,” said the Chinese statement. “Our hearts go out to all those affected.”

While this incident highlights the ongoing challenge of terrorism, both Turkey and China remain steadfast in their support for Pakistan’s fight against extremism. The leaders’ joint statements underscored their shared commitment to upholding peace and security in the region.
